Deputy Brady has one or two additional questions, but I want to ask a few of my own first. On unaccompanied minors specifically, do we have the exact figure at the moment? What is the breakdown? Are most unaccompanied minors in foster families, in residential centres or is it a mix? When somebody presents in that situation, let us say they arrive at the airport, where are they directed to? What sort of situation are they in even in the initial hours or days? I am conscious of child protection, which Deputy Sherlock raised. It is obviously a very traumatising situation for a child, so I would like some information on the unaccompanied minors.
